Transaction 795777959fcfbe37646354297ac095946d0876838c4de3271757e7600a89a10e
1 Input
1 Output
-
795777959fcfbe37646354297ac095946d0876838c4de3271757e7600a89a10e:0
- value
- 8439883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b870571c2a6ae796780d06106620314acec0dbe OP_EQUAL
- address
- 3Jna2rj4b7c4VHfPbCxqqMJY7bJ5NqBGbW